3-Methyl-4-nitroanisole

CAS:
5367-32-8
Molecular Weight: | 167.16 g./mol | Molecular Formula: | C₈H₉NO₃ |
---|---|---|---|
EC Number: | 226-356-9 | MDL Number: | MFCD00007167 |
Melting Point: | 48-50 °C(lit.) | Boiling Point: | 135 °C / 0.5mmHg |
Density: | Storage Condition: | room temperature, flammable area |
Product Description:
Used primarily in the synthesis of dyes and pigments, it serves as an intermediate in the production of colorants for textiles and other materials. Its nitro and methoxy functional groups make it valuable in organic reactions, particularly in the development of complex chemical structures. Additionally, it finds application in research laboratories for studying nitration and methylation processes. In the pharmaceutical industry, it can be utilized as a building block for the synthesis of certain active compounds. Its role in creating specialized chemicals highlights its importance in industrial and scientific applications.
